Let your lips travel my skin, oh forbidden lover mine,
Like yesterday, yesteryear
Let roaming fingers hitchhike my flesh, my roads open for you
As kisses fall like rain
Let your lips erase thoughts from my mind,
Banish these doubts from my heart,
For a moment with you is forever,
Even when moments should be spent
With the one waiting for me at home
Or with your Someone far off, away.
Let it be known that we are not perfect,
But together less imperfect, less flawed
And though we are apart
Let us be together, for now,
Right now...
A message is on my machine.
"Where are you? We'll be late..
Hope you're home soon..
Love you."
Ignored.
